About Us
The Lake County Coalition is among 31 organizations in Florida established by state legislation in 2000 through the School Readiness Act. The Coalition provides a variety of innovative early childhood education and Voluntary Pre-Kindergarten for children ranging from birth to age five, as well as after school programs for children to age twelve.
The Coalition contracts with LifeStream Behavior Child Care Choice Services (CCCS) to provide child care resources and referrals for families in Lake County. CCCS works directly with child care providers to oversee the reimbursement process for school readiness and VPK services, attendance monitoring, health reviews, developmental screenings and assessments, ongoing provider support and trainings, as well as technical assistance as needed. In addition to helping parents find child care services, the staff of CCCS also provides case management and family support for their clients.
Child Care Choice Services also works with parents to determine eligibility for subsidized child care. This School Readiness program is designed to provide financial assistance to parents for child care while striving to become self-sufficient. The program is based on family income and family size as determined by the federal income poverty guidelines.
